**Wiki: Building Access — Spare Hardware Store (Room G14)**

Room G14 at Tanwick Court holds spare monitors, docks, and cabling for the facilities desk. Access is restricted to facilities staff only; log every item removed in the ledger inside the door. The room uses a standalone keypad rather than badge readers, so it won't appear in the access system. Enter the current code at the keypad:

turnstile pass: bdg-TXR-4

## Changelog — Ticktrace 1.9

### Renamed: DRIFT_API_TOKEN
During the cron drift investigation we found plugins confusing this variable with the metrics token, so it has been renamed to indicate it authorizes drift-report uploads specifically. Plugin authors must read the new name from 1.9 onward; the old name is ignored without warning. Sample env files in the SDK are updated. In your deployment env file, the drift-report upload secret is set on the next line.

env line for fawef-taguf: VAULT_KEY13=a9695905a9a90

The session envelope—user identity, survey assignment, and a monotonic sequence counter—is persisted to encrypted local storage. All captured records are queued with that counter so the sync service can detect gaps on reconnection.

On reconnect, the client must revalidate the session before flushing the queue; expired sessions trigger a silent refresh, preserving queued data. Revalidation calls authenticate against the Fernledger gateway using the bearer token that follows.

login token, bagug-kafop: eyJhbGciOiJIUzI1NiIsInR5cCI6IkpXVCJ9.eyJzdWIiOiIcMLov2In0.Z5RLDIfp